update: for WINE 1.3.22 we need to disable GL_EXT_texture_sRGB_decode OpenGL extension as Intel driver has bug with this extension. Disable this extension by the following command before run the game from termnal:
export MESA_EXTENSION_OVERRIDE=-GL_EXT_texture_sRGB_decode

For WINE 1.3.23 and up use:
export MESA_EXTENSION_OVERRIDE="-GL_EXT_texture_sRGB_decode -GL_ARB_draw_elements_base_vertex -GL_ARB_map_buffer_range"

Or

put this command in .gnomerc or .profile file in the HOME directory, so that we do not need to put this command every time we launch the game.


WINE settings
------------------------------------------------------------

http://wiki.winehq.org/UsefulRegistryKeys

Direct3D Section:
DirectDrawRenderer = gdi
OffscreenRenderingMode = fbo
PixelShaderMode = enabled
RederTargetLockMode = readtex
UseGLSL = disabled
VertexShaderMode = hardware
VideoMemorySize = 256
VideoPciDeviceID = "your device id"
VideoPciVendorID = 8086

Alsa Driver section:
DeviceCTLn = cards.pcm.default
DevicePCMn = cards.pcm.default
